15-Year-Old Anglo-Nigerian Striker Finishes As Man Utd's Top Scorer At International Sparkasse & VGH Cup
Published: January 12, 2020
England U16 international of Nigerian descent, Shola Shoretire finished as Manchester United's top scorer at the International Sparkasse & VGH Cup, overtaking fellow Nigeria-eligible Dillon Hoogewerf before the Old Trafford outfit were knocked out of the tournament.
Needing only a draw to qualify for the quarterfinals, United did not progress after they were beaten 3-0 by Hannover.
Hoogewerf, who was on seven goals at the start of the day, could not add to his tally on Sunday.
In their first match, the Red Devils U19 side played out an eight-goal thriller (4-4) with Werder Bremen, with the 15-year-old Shoretire finding the net on two occasions to take his tally to eight goals.
Zidane Iqbal, Connor Stanley and Omari Forson scored 5, 4 and 3 goals respectively, while Sotona struck once.
Manchester United won the 2017 and 2018 editions of the International Sparkasse & VGH Cup.
Nigerian left-back Idris Odutayo represented Fulham in this year's tournament in Göttingen.
